Dhamtari, Oct 15 (NationPress) As numerous nations grapple with food shortages, India, under the guidance of Prime Minister Narendra Modi, remains steadfast with an abundant supply of food grains. Essential provisions are being made accessible to all, from the economically disadvantaged to the general populace, at reasonable prices, offering significant relief to many households.

In the Dhamtari district of Chhattisgarh, the state government is distributing 30 kg of food grains per family under the Pradhan Mantri Garib Kalyan Anna Yojana, while the central government contributes an additional 5 kg per person. This initiative has enabled numerous impoverished families to attain food security, alleviating their concerns about having two meals daily.

Both the central and state governments are dedicated to ensuring that no individual in the country goes to bed hungry. Through this program, food grains are being provided to the economically disadvantaged and middle-class families at significantly subsidized or complimentary rates. Millions nationwide are reaping the benefits of this initiative, which allows individuals to live with dignity and tranquility.

This scheme served as a lifeline during the COVID-19 pandemic when work and business activities were halted. For many, it was an essential source of support.

Residents of Dhamtari have reported that prior to this scheme, they struggled to afford two meals a day. With rising grain prices, a considerable portion of their income was spent on food. However, since the Modi government took charge, their concerns about food have considerably diminished.

One beneficiary, Vinita Kothari, mentioned that she receives 35 kg of food grains monthly through her ration card, sufficient to sustain her entire family. Tribal families residing in forested regions are also receiving necessary items such as grains, pulses, sugar, and salt. Vinita conveyed her deep appreciation to both the central and state governments for their unwavering support.

The Pradhan Mantri Garib Kalyan Anna Yojana is a key welfare initiative under the Atmanirbhar Bharat program, aimed at providing free food grains to the underprivileged and migrant workers.

This scheme has been executed in various phases: Phase I and II from April to November 2020, Phase III in May and June 2021, Phase IV from July to November 2021, and Phase V from December 2021 to March 2022.

Under PM-GKAY, the central government allocates 5 kg of free food grains per person monthly, in addition to the subsidized rations already being distributed under the National Food Security Act (NFSA) through the Public Distribution System (PDS).
